C++98 came before C99, so who diverged from whom?

You seem to not not how the C++ standard was made. In fact, it come before C99, like it or not. The intention was that C++ would come up with a follow on standard that tracked C99, in next revision, as the 98 revision just didn't allow for it time wise.


It is entirely reasonable to pressfit those aspects of C99 that makes sense in the confines of the C++ standard, into C++. long long is my favorite example of this. We wanted to do it, but, the C99 standard wasn't done enough for our tastes.
